Latest Patents
Nguyen holds a patent titled "Method for detecting a perturbation by hysteretic cycle using a nonlinear electromechanical resonator and device using the method." This patent describes a method for detecting perturbations in devices that include resonant mechanical elements. The method leverages the sensitivity of these elements to changes in resonance frequency caused by perturbations. Additionally, the patent outlines a device that employs this method, featuring electromechanical resonators with nonlinear behavior and transducer means for signal detection and analysis. The invention also includes applications for mass sensors and mass spectrometers.
